Tired of paying for Norton's cybersecurity protection? You're not alone! Many users find that Norton is no longer the best value for their money. Fortunately, cancelling your subscription is a pretty simple process. Follow these steps to break free Norton and save yourself some cash.
- Begin by logging into your Norton account online.
- Next, navigate to the "Account Management" section.
- Find the option to cancel your subscription.
- Choose the cancellation button.
- Confirm your cancellation request. You may be asked to submit a reason for cancelling.
And you're done!

How to Ditch Norton Safely and Easily
Want to jettison your Norton antivirus software? It's a process that can feel daunting, but don't fret. With the right steps, you can uninstall Norton easily and ensure your system is clean. First things first, obtain Norton's uninstaller from their company site. Run this tool and go through the on-screen directions. This tool will handle most of the heavy lifting, erasing Norton's core programs and options.
- After the removal tool, it's a good thought to reboot your computer. This helps make sure that all changes are applied.
- Next, verify your system for any leftover Norton programs. You can use a file search to find any files that have not been removed. In case you find any, delete them manually.
Finally, it's a good idea to run a full system analysis with your check here preferred antivirus software. This will help in guaranteeing that your system is completely safe.
Frustrated of Norton? The Complete Cancellation Process
Ready to sever ties with Norton and explore other security solutions? We get it! Sometimes a change is needed. Luckily, canceling your Norton subscription is a relatively straightforward process. To start, you'll need to find your account information. This usually involves visiting the Norton website and logging in with your account details. Once logged in, head over to the "My Account" or "Subscriptions" section. Here, you should find a button or link that says something like "Cancel Subscription" or "Manage Subscriptions".
- Tapping on this will usually take you to a confirmation page where you can review your subscription details and confirm your cancellation request.
- Double-check to read through the terms and conditions carefully before proceeding, as there may be some important information about refunds or future billing.
Following confirmation, Norton will usually send you a confirmation email. Keep this email for your records. That's it! Your Norton subscription is now canceled and you can explore other options with confidence.
